自由收听的音频本地化解决方案突破平台限制的技术实践【免费下载链接】xmly-downloader-qt5喜马拉雅FM专辑下载器. 支持VIP与付费专辑. 使用GoQt5编写(Not Qt Binding).项目地址: https://gitcode.com/gh_mirrors/xm/xmly-downloader-qt5音频本地化与自由收听是当代数字内容消费的核心需求尤其在网络不稳定或无网络环境下如何突破平台限制实现音频内容的离线访问成为用户痛点。本文将系统介绍一款基于Qt5开发的音频本地化工具通过技术解析与实践指南帮助用户构建个人音频库实现跨设备的自由收听体验。场景痛点为什么需要音频本地化解决方案在数字内容消费中用户常面临三大核心痛点网络依赖导致的收听中断、平台限制造成的内容访问壁垒、以及跨设备音频管理的复杂性。长途旅行中高铁或偏远地区的网络不稳定使在线收听频繁中断企业内网或校园网络环境下外部音频平台访问受限多设备间的音频同步困难导致用户体验碎片化。这些问题催生了对音频本地化解决方案的迫切需求。技术实现如何构建突破限制的音频下载工具核心技术架构解析该音频本地化工具采用GoQt5混合开发架构通过Qt5构建跨平台图形界面Go语言实现音频解析与下载核心逻辑。工具通过模拟用户授权流程实现已购内容的合法本地化。核心机制包括基于HTTP协议的会话管理、音频资源URL解析、多线程任务调度和断点续传。技术栈组合确保了工具的跨平台兼容性和高效性能。关键技术参数对比技术指标本工具实现传统下载工具并发任务数可调节1-10固定通常2-3格式支持MP3/M4A双格式单一MP3断点续传支持部分支持账号验证二维码/手动Cookie无/第三方依赖界面主题4种自定义主题无/单一主题图1工具主界面展示了专辑解析、账号登录和音频管理功能区域使用指南如何从零开始实现音频本地化环境配置阶段 安装依赖确保系统已安装Qt 5.12和Go 1.14开发环境 获取源码执行git clone https://gitcode.com/gh_mirrors/xm/xmly-downloader-qt5 编译项目进入源码目录按README说明完成编译构建功能激活阶段 启动工具后通过两种方式激活VIP功能扫描界面二维码使用手机APP授权手动输入包含1token的Cookie信息 验证成功后界面将显示用户名和VIP状态内容管理阶段 在有声小说ID框输入专辑数字ID点击解析获取内容列表 勾选需要下载的音频章节选择输出格式MP3/M4A 设置存储路径点击下载选中开始任务可实时监控进度图2下载管理窗口展示了任务队列、进度条和状态监控功能价值验证音频本地化如何改变收听体验长途旅行场景解决方案商务旅行者王先生经常面临跨地区网络波动问题。使用该工具后他在出发前下载整季课程音频在飞行或高铁途中无需网络即可不间断学习。现在我可以把碎片时间充分利用起来不受网络条件限制。王先生反馈工具的批量下载和断点续传功能特别适合长时间出行使用。网络受限环境应用科研人员李女士所在实验室网络严格限制外部访问。通过本工具她可以在家中下载学术讲座音频带回实验室离线收听。这解决了我工作学习中的一大障碍让知识获取不再受网络环境制约。李女士特别提到多主题切换功能使她能在不同光线环境下保持舒适的视觉体验。图3扁平白主题适合明亮环境使用图4PS黑主题适合低光环境使用 使用技巧根据环境光线在默认、扁平白、淡蓝和PS黑四种主题间切换可有效减少视觉疲劳提升长时间使用体验。⚠️ 重要提示本工具仅用于个人学习和备份已获授权的音频内容音频版权归原平台所有。用户应遵守内容使用协议不得将本地化内容用于商业用途或非法传播。通过这款音频本地化工具用户可以突破平台限制和网络依赖构建个人音频库实现真正意义上的自由收听。无论是专业学习、文化娱乐还是信息获取音频本地化都为用户提供了更灵活、更自主的内容消费方式重新定义数字时代的听书体验。【免费下载链接】xmly-downloader-qt5喜马拉雅FM专辑下载器. 支持VIP与付费专辑. 使用GoQt5编写(Not Qt Binding).项目地址: https://gitcode.com/gh_mirrors/xm/xmly-downloader-qt5创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考
自由收听的音频本地化解决方案:突破平台限制的技术实践
自由收听的音频本地化解决方案突破平台限制的技术实践【免费下载链接】xmly-downloader-qt5喜马拉雅FM专辑下载器. 支持VIP与付费专辑. 使用GoQt5编写(Not Qt Binding).项目地址: https://gitcode.com/gh_mirrors/xm/xmly-downloader-qt5音频本地化与自由收听是当代数字内容消费的核心需求尤其在网络不稳定或无网络环境下如何突破平台限制实现音频内容的离线访问成为用户痛点。本文将系统介绍一款基于Qt5开发的音频本地化工具通过技术解析与实践指南帮助用户构建个人音频库实现跨设备的自由收听体验。场景痛点为什么需要音频本地化解决方案在数字内容消费中用户常面临三大核心痛点网络依赖导致的收听中断、平台限制造成的内容访问壁垒、以及跨设备音频管理的复杂性。长途旅行中高铁或偏远地区的网络不稳定使在线收听频繁中断企业内网或校园网络环境下外部音频平台访问受限多设备间的音频同步困难导致用户体验碎片化。这些问题催生了对音频本地化解决方案的迫切需求。技术实现如何构建突破限制的音频下载工具核心技术架构解析该音频本地化工具采用GoQt5混合开发架构通过Qt5构建跨平台图形界面Go语言实现音频解析与下载核心逻辑。工具通过模拟用户授权流程实现已购内容的合法本地化。核心机制包括基于HTTP协议的会话管理、音频资源URL解析、多线程任务调度和断点续传。技术栈组合确保了工具的跨平台兼容性和高效性能。关键技术参数对比技术指标本工具实现传统下载工具并发任务数可调节1-10固定通常2-3格式支持MP3/M4A双格式单一MP3断点续传支持部分支持账号验证二维码/手动Cookie无/第三方依赖界面主题4种自定义主题无/单一主题图1工具主界面展示了专辑解析、账号登录和音频管理功能区域使用指南如何从零开始实现音频本地化环境配置阶段 安装依赖确保系统已安装Qt 5.12和Go 1.14开发环境 获取源码执行git clone https://gitcode.com/gh_mirrors/xm/xmly-downloader-qt5 编译项目进入源码目录按README说明完成编译构建功能激活阶段 启动工具后通过两种方式激活VIP功能扫描界面二维码使用手机APP授权手动输入包含1token的Cookie信息 验证成功后界面将显示用户名和VIP状态内容管理阶段 在有声小说ID框输入专辑数字ID点击解析获取内容列表 勾选需要下载的音频章节选择输出格式MP3/M4A 设置存储路径点击下载选中开始任务可实时监控进度图2下载管理窗口展示了任务队列、进度条和状态监控功能价值验证音频本地化如何改变收听体验长途旅行场景解决方案商务旅行者王先生经常面临跨地区网络波动问题。使用该工具后他在出发前下载整季课程音频在飞行或高铁途中无需网络即可不间断学习。现在我可以把碎片时间充分利用起来不受网络条件限制。王先生反馈工具的批量下载和断点续传功能特别适合长时间出行使用。网络受限环境应用科研人员李女士所在实验室网络严格限制外部访问。通过本工具她可以在家中下载学术讲座音频带回实验室离线收听。这解决了我工作学习中的一大障碍让知识获取不再受网络环境制约。李女士特别提到多主题切换功能使她能在不同光线环境下保持舒适的视觉体验。图3扁平白主题适合明亮环境使用图4PS黑主题适合低光环境使用 使用技巧根据环境光线在默认、扁平白、淡蓝和PS黑四种主题间切换可有效减少视觉疲劳提升长时间使用体验。⚠️ 重要提示本工具仅用于个人学习和备份已获授权的音频内容音频版权归原平台所有。用户应遵守内容使用协议不得将本地化内容用于商业用途或非法传播。通过这款音频本地化工具用户可以突破平台限制和网络依赖构建个人音频库实现真正意义上的自由收听。无论是专业学习、文化娱乐还是信息获取音频本地化都为用户提供了更灵活、更自主的内容消费方式重新定义数字时代的听书体验。【免费下载链接】xmly-downloader-qt5喜马拉雅FM专辑下载器. 支持VIP与付费专辑. 使用GoQt5编写(Not Qt Binding).项目地址: https://gitcode.com/gh_mirrors/xm/xmly-downloader-qt5创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考